Jason Matthews (1951 April 28, 2021) was an American author of espionage novels and former CIA officer, best known for the Red Sparrow spy novel trilogy. NEW YORK, April 29 New York Times bestselling author and retired CIA officer Jason Matthews died yesterday after a prolonged battle with Corticobasal Degeneration (CBD), a rare, untreatable neurodegenerative disease. Born in Wethersfield, Connecticut, Matthews grew up in a Greek-speaking household, majored in foreign languages at Washington & Lee University, studied journalism at the University of Missouri and eventually learned French, Spanish, Italian, Turkish, and Hungarian. Retired CIA officer and New York Times bestselling author of the acclaimed "Red Sparrow Trilogy" Jason Matthews died on April 28, 2021 in Rancho Mirage after a long, courageous battle with a rare neurodegenerative disease.
